![]() ![]() The resulting music inevitably sounds very much of its time. Sadly, Cedric Sharpley passed away in March 2012 from a heart attack. It has been curated with the full support of surviving Dramatis members Rrussell Bell, Chris Payne, and Denis Haines. This release of For Future Reference revisits those releases and comprises the album remastered from the original tapes, singles, some bonus tracks and a previously unreleased BBC In Concert performance from Paris Theatre, London, in 1982. The band remained pretty much in the synth-pop realm and released seven singles and an album before calling it a day in 1982. When he seemed to announce his retirement in April 1981, short lived as it turned out as he soon charged on with his solo career, others of his band decided to carry on working with each other and formed the group Dramatis. Chris Payne (vocals, keyboards), Rrussell Bell (guitars, keyboards), Cedric Sharpley (drums), with Denis Haines (keyboards) had been a part of Gary Numan’s band Tubeway Army. ![]() Readers of a certain vintage may have heard the members of this band before and not realised it. ![]()
